      🔥 Why is French so challenging and are there ways to learn it in a better way?

      One-size-fits-all language instruction practiced in schools is not the most effective way to learn French. In reality, you can gain basic French fluency in 300 hours from zero knowledge. Studying and getting feedback five hours a week you will be able to understand common expressions, be understood when you talk, do most everyday tasks in about a year. Finding native speakers is not a practical option for everyone, so online classes are a quick and enjoyable way of acquiring the basic knowledge of French. After gaining basic skills, online marketplaces like LearnZone have French tutors who specialize in intensive classes for intermediate and advanced learners.

      🤷 How long does it take to get better at speaking French?

      Some people seem to have a natural ability and learn languages quickly, but for most to go beyond the basics and gain working fluency in French will take at least 600 hours of practice. The amount of time can differ significantly depending on your available level of French or knowledge of other languages in the same group. As soon as you've learned the basics it is recommended to use the language as often as possible: watch videos, start a journal or write posts and comments using your new language skills, find native speakers to speak with, try as many as possible ways to think and speak in French out loud. If you're struggling when starting a discusssion you can also take conversational French classes online.

      🗓 What time of day and on which days are classes available?

      Colleges usually structure classes two times weekly over a semester (75-day period). Language schools as a rule have shorter, 8-week, 12-week, and 16-week course sessions. Online, allows the flexibility to schedule lessons around your commitments, on weekdays and/or weekends.
